Default Re: Cheap L88

There were a number of factors that led to the low selling price. First, the car while it appears nice enough really needs to be restored if you are going to show it. With frame offs approaching and sometimes surpassing six figures that was one factor. Another issue was that the car does not have its original motor which impacts the value a great deal on these cars. Third the seller wanted to sell and the car went on the block late so that usually does not favor the seller.
